Output 344433bdf30986fb9530d978c1f77324d8e652fe38cd7d2dc1ed16164ff9a60e:0

value
301568
script pubkey
OP_0 OP_PUSHBYTES_20 b9328497101d817c3c01922741ff9b1df5ce3b94
address
bc1qhyegf9csrkqhc0qpjgn5rlumrh6uuwu5tm5gnl
transaction
344433bdf30986fb9530d978c1f77324d8e652fe38cd7d2dc1ed16164ff9a60e
spent
true